jsw/commonmark-danraku-extension
最新稳定版本:1.0.3
Composer 安装命令:
composer require jsw/commonmark-danraku-extension
包简介
League/commonmark extension for japanese danraku style.
README 文档
README
League/CommonMark extension for japanese danraku style.
自動で段落の頭に全角スペースを入れてくれたり、区切り約物の直後に全角スペースを入れてくれるLeague/CommonMark拡張機能。
Installation
$ composer require jsw/commonmark-danraku-extension
Usage
$environment = new Environment($config); $environment ->addExtension(new CommonMarkCoreExtension()) ->addExtension(new DanrakuExtension()); $converter = new MarkdownConverter($environment); $markdown = 'この拡張機能は実によい・・・まさに革命的だ'; //<p> この拡張機能は実によい・・・まさに革命的だ</p> echo $converter->convert($markdown);
config
// 以下、デフォルトでの設定 $config = [ 'jisage' => [ 'ignore_alphabet' => false, // trueにすると、行頭が英数字だった場合には字下げをしなくなる 'ignore_dash' => true, // trueにすると、全角ダッシュ(―)、ハイフンで字下げをしなくなる ], 'yakumono' => [ 'spacing_yakumono' => true, // trueにすると、「?」と「!」の前に全角スペースを空けるようになる(閉じ括弧の直前を除く) 'byte_sensitive' => true, // trueにすると、全角「?」「!」の場合は全角スペースを、半角「!」「?」の場合は半角スペースを挿入するようになる ], ];
Licence
Apache License, Version 2.0
统计信息
- 总下载量: 15
- 月度下载量: 0
- 日度下载量: 0
- 收藏数: 0
- 点击次数: 0
- 依赖项目数: 0
- 推荐数: 1
其他信息
- 授权协议: Apache-2.0
- 更新时间: 2023-02-20